## Alert: StatRelay Sidecar Flush Lag

This alert fires when the StatRelay metrics-aggregation sidecar falls more than 120 seconds behind on flushing buffered samples to the Coalmine backend. Plugin-emitted counters are buffered in-process, so sustained lag usually means a plugin is emitting unbounded label cardinality or blocking the flush thread. Check your plugin's metric registration against the published cardinality limits before escalating. If the lag persists after your plugin is ruled out, contact the telemetry team.

escalation mailbox, bagug-fahof: novdor.wendor.jormir@norvalabs.example

Welcome to the Ledgerpine team. Our Tallowmark conversion service once accumulated rounding drift because per-line conversions were rounded before summing; we now convert totals in minor units and round once, banker's style. When setting up your local environment, copy the sample env file and verify the rounding mode flag matches production. The service also needs access to the rates vault to fetch daily tables, and the next line in your env file sets that credential.

secret setting of yafof-tawep: RELAY_SECRET8=8abb5772

Test Plan: GraphGlance dependency visualizer

Heads up for on-call — we're running the load tests Thursday night. Expect the renderer to chew through the big Monolith-of-Doom graph (about 40k edges), so CPU alerts on the viz pods may fire. Don't page anyone unless render times top five minutes. Smoke checks hit the graph API every ten minutes; if those fail, poke the cache first. The checks authenticate with the bearer token below.

session JWT of yawep-yawep = eyJhbGciOiJIUzI1NiIsInR5cCI6IkpXVCJ9.eyJzdWIiOiI3pWF3_In0.aXYsHiog

## Deployment

The Tumblewick fuel-usage report ships as a single container and runs on a weekly cron. It pulls odometer and pump data from the Haulpoint warehouse, crunches per-vehicle numbers, and drops a CSV in the shared bucket. Nothing fancy — just make sure the cron node has the values below set.

service settings:
HOLDOR_PIN=6477
HOLDOR_METRICS_HOST=metrics.holdor.nelvrocorp.corp
HOLDOR_LOG_LEVEL=error
HOLDOR_TENANT=noviel